UNI Global Union is calling for an urgent update of the database maintained by the UN Human Rights Office that tracks enterprises conducting business in Israeli settlements in the Occupied Palestinian Territories, and the global union is supporting the\u00a0<\/span>ITUC petition<\/span><\/a><\/span>\u00a0on the matter launched last week.<\/span><\/p>\r\n

First published in 2020, following a four-year delay, the database is an invaluable resource in identifying those companies whose activities have \u201c<\/span>directly and indirectly, enabled, facilitated and profited from the construction and growth of the settlements<\/span>.\u201d\u00a0 These settlements are illegal under international law, and the database is used by a broad swath of civil society, human rights defenders and socially responsible investors.<\/span><\/p>\r\n

Currently, t<\/span>he database is\u00a0<\/span>significantly\u00a0<\/span>out of date and urgently needs updating to help expose and end corporate complicity in the illegal occupation.<\/b>\u00a0Adding and removing companies from the database creates a necessary incentive and deterrent against engaging with Israel\u2019s illegal settlement industry.<\/span><\/p>\r\n

UNI has previously used information contained within the database to engage in dialogue with\u00a0<\/span>Norway\u2019s largest pension fund KLP<\/span>, which led to them<\/span>\u00a0divest<\/span>ing<\/span>\u00a0from 16 companies due to their ties to Israeli settlements in the occupied West Bank<\/span>. UNI reached out to\u00a0<\/span>Norway\u2019s sovereign wealth fund, managed by Norges Bank,\u00a0<\/span>who\u00a0<\/span>pulled out of construction and real estate companies in the Palestinian territories<\/span><\/p>\r\n

UNI General Secretary Christy Hoffman said:<\/span><\/p>\r\n

\u201cC<\/span>ompanies identified by the\u00a0UN\u00a0<\/span>in this database\u00a0<\/span>as enabling the settlements are unacceptably intertwined with human rights abuses<\/span>.\u00a0 The database is a crucial tool that shines a light on companies active in the settlements and rightly adds to the pressure on business to withdraw.\u00a0 But it is only as useful as the information contained within it. That is why it is absolutely necessary for the database to be updated now and maintained going forward.\u201d<\/span><\/p>\r\n

Resolutions adopted at the UNI World Congresses in 2014 and 2018 included explicit<\/span>\u00a0call<\/span>s<\/span>\u00a0for action to end economic support for the illegal settlements, which are an impediment to peace and put the two-state solution beyond reach.<\/span><\/p>\r\n
